Three-dimensional isosurface view of CLSM image stacks. The squared base has an area of 230 mm  230 mm; EPS glycoconjugates are shown in green (lectin isolated from Aleuria aurantia marked with Alexa-Fluor488), nucleic acids are red (SYTO60).
